Job description: Drive and administer the RAF’s fleet of ground vehicles

Please note this trade is receiving a high volume of applications and is currently over-subscribed.

Pay after one year: £17,485

Joining age: 17 – 29

Category: Airmen/airwomen

Usual service: 9 years

Open to: men or women

Similar civilian jobs:

  • Heavy goods vehicle driver
  • Chauffeur/VIP driver
  • Driving instructor
  • Coach/bus driver
  • Mobile crane operator
  • Driver of hazardous loads under ADR regulations
  • Forklift truck operator

Qualifications you need: 2 GCSEs/SCEs at Grade G/6 minimum or equivalent in English language and maths. A provisional driving licence is also required

Qualifications you can gain: NVQ Level 2 and 3 in driving goods vehicles; City & Guilds in carrying dangerous goods; driving licences including Car (B), LGV (C+E) and Coach (D) licences

Nationality: Citizen of the UK or the Republic of Ireland, or a Commonwealth citizen since birth

The job

Drivers are specifically employed to provide the RAF with a professional driver capability. You will be required to drive, operate and administer the RAF’s fleet of ground vehicles. This fleet ranges from light motor vehicles to minibuses, large goods vehicles, passenger carrying vehicles, ambulances and specialist airfield support equipment such as refuellers, aircraft tractors and mobile cranes. These vehicles, along with the Drivers, play an important role in the operational effectiveness of the RAF, ensuring that people and equipment are available in the right place, at the right time. As a Driver, you’ll often be required to operate independently, away from your unit, so you’ll need initiative and self-confidence.
